Business value

The Preview Posting action helps you avoid mistakes by giving you the chance to review the types of entries that will be created when you post item journals or other inventory documents before you commit the changes to your database.

Feature details

When you post item journals or other warehouse documents, such as inventory picks and put-aways and warehouse shipments and receipts, you create different types of G/L entries. The following are examples:

  • Item entries
  • G/L entries
  • Value entries
  • Warehouse entries

To avoid mistakes upfront, use the Preview Posting action on journals and documents to review the types of entries that you'll create before you post them.

List of pages where Preview Posting was added

  • Warehouse Shipment
  • Transfer Order
  • Assembly Order
  • Production Journal
  • Warehouse Receipt
  • Item Journal
  • Inventory Pick
  • Item Reclass. Journal
  • Job Journal
  • Phys. Inventory Journal
  • Output Journal
  • Inventory Put-away
  • Consumption Journal
  • Physical Inventory Order
  • Revaluation Journal
  • Invt. Shipment
  • Invt. Receipt
  • Recurring Job Jnl.
  • Capacity Journal
  • Recurring Consumption Journal
  • Recurring Capacity Journal
